Youyou Foods Co Ltd (603697)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 75.8% as of September 2025.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of CN¥2.32 Billion minus total liabilities of CN¥562.67 Million yields net assets of CN¥1.76 Billion. Annual Net Asset Quality Index for Youyou Foods Co Ltd (2012–2024)

The table below presents the year-by-year Net Asset Quality Index for Youyou Foods Co Ltd from 2012 to 2024, covering 13 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, total liabilities, net assets, the quality index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year Quality Index Net Assets (CNY) Total Assets Total Liabilities Change (pp)
2024 86.7% CN¥1.77 Billion CN¥2.05 Billion CN¥272.83 Million ▼ -5.9 pp
2023 92.6% CN¥1.84 Billion CN¥1.98 Billion CN¥147.01 Million ▲ +1.8 pp
2022 90.8% CN¥1.86 Billion CN¥2.05 Billion CN¥188.12 Million ▲ +1.1 pp
2021 89.7% CN¥1.90 Billion CN¥2.12 Billion CN¥217.18 Million ▼ -2.2 pp
2020 92.0% CN¥1.77 Billion CN¥1.92 Billion CN¥154.06 Million ▲ +2.2 pp
2019 89.8% CN¥1.57 Billion CN¥1.74 Billion CN¥178.00 Million ▲ +3.6 pp
2018 86.2% CN¥880.33 Million CN¥1.02 Billion CN¥140.50 Million ▲ +7.9 pp
2017 78.4% CN¥702.13 Million CN¥895.80 Million CN¥193.67 Million ▲ +0.2 pp
2016 78.2% CN¥552.30 Million CN¥706.07 Million CN¥153.77 Million ▼ -1.0 pp
2015 79.2% CN¥463.55 Million CN¥585.49 Million CN¥121.93 Million ▲ +3.8 pp
2014 75.4% CN¥370.69 Million CN¥491.55 Million CN¥120.86 Million ▲ +8.7 pp
2013 66.7% CN¥252.14 Million CN¥378.09 Million CN¥125.95 Million ▼ -3.6 pp
2012 70.3% CN¥201.57 Million CN¥286.68 Million CN¥85.11 Million
pp = percentage points
